Abstract |
This study investigates the impact of digital transformation on green innovation in China's manufacturing sector-a leading energy-consuming industry, using panel data and employing a two-way fixed-effects model alongside a spatial Durbin model. The findings reveal a significant positive relationship between digitalization and green innovation in energy transition, most notably in eastern China and regions with advanced digital infrastructure. This relationship is further characterized by increased R&D investment, driven by the efficient allocation of digital resources. A key discovery is the presence of significant spatial spillovers, indicating that digital advancements in one region positively influence green innovation in neighboring areas. These insights underscore the importance of region-specific development strategies and research incentives to harness digital transformation as a catalyst for green technology innovation. This analysis provides a deeper understanding of the regional interconnections between digitalization and innovation, offering valuable policy guidance for sustainable development. |
